The RTL8822BE is a high-performance Dual-Band WiFi and Bluetooth combo module designed to upgrade the wireless capabilities of laptops and mini PCs. Powered by the Realtek RTL8822BE chipset, this M.2 NGFF card supports the 802.11ac standard, delivering high-speed connectivity with a maximum throughput of 867Mbps on the 5GHz band and 300Mbps on the 2.4GHz band. It features integrated Bluetooth 4.2 technology, allowing seamless connection to peripherals like headphones, keyboards, and mice.
This module is engineered for stability and low power consumption, making it ideal for streaming, online gaming, and large file transfers. It adopts the standard M.2 2230 form factor, ensuring compatibility with a wide range of modern laptops (HP, Dell, Asus, Acer) and desktops with M.2 Key A or Key E slots. Note: Not compatible with Lenovo/IBM or HP models with strict BIOS whitelists unless specified.

| Technical | |
| Model | RTL8822BE |
| Antenna Type | IPEX MHF4 (External) |
| Bluetooth protocol | 4.2 |
| Compatible With | Windows 7, 8, 10, 11 |
| Frequency | 2.4GHz / 5GHz |
| Interface Type | M.2 NGFF (Key A/E) |
| Transfer rate | 867Mbps (5G) / 300Mbps (2.4G) |
| Weight | 6gm |
| Wi-Fi IC | Realtek RTL8822BE |
| Wireless Standards | 802.11ac/a/b/g/n |
| Working temperature | 0°C ~ 80°C |
| Dimensions (LxWxH) | 22 x 30 x 2.4 mm |
